Transaction 2de266384fcc2b0ffd163ff259ced34b267be28ef859b52411f1b5026c7a368a
1 Input
1 Output
-
2de266384fcc2b0ffd163ff259ced34b267be28ef859b52411f1b5026c7a368a:0
- value
- 1085306
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d9736a22d1e327aeccc136177b0216ad39b8890 OP_EQUAL
- address
- 37JgHjj7ix1ic11qR6h1Kw9LSQoDJAPKJd